The Neighborhood Development Office (https://lawmo.org/get-legal-help/#tab-1532104905484-2-10) of Legal Aid of Western Missouri is seeking a full-time attorney for its Paseo Office in Kansas City. In this role, you will serve as counsel to neighborhood associations to revitalize and strengthen Kansas City's neighborhoods. Your clients are the organizations closest to the ground, and your legal work directly advances blight remediation, affordable housing preservation, and community reinvestment. It is a chance to use a transactional and litigation practice to help neighborhoods reshape their own blocks. Because the work is rooted in the community, the role involves significant time in Kansas City neighborhoods, including local travel and some evening and weekend work.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Represent neighborhood associations and work with nonprofit community development corporations in real estate transactions that advance blight remediation, affordable housing preservation, and community reinvestment.
  • Handle civil land-use litigation on behalf of community clients, including matters related to distressed and vacant property.
  • Advise community partners on the legal aspects of targeted improvement initiatives, from acquisition and title issues through project completion.
  • Draft and negotiate transactional documents such as purchase agreements, deeds, leases, and related real estate instruments.
  • Build and maintain working relationships with neighborhood associations, community development corporations, and other local partners in the neighborhoods served.
  • Work directly in and with Kansas City neighborhoods, including local travel and some evening and weekend availability for community meetings, outreach, and events.
  • Collaborate with colleagues across the Neighborhood Development Office and Legal Aid to deliver high-quality, coordinated legal services.
